The gaza reconstruction project includes several stages, which Egyptian President Abdel Fattah al-Sisi announced a $500 million grant to support the reconstruction of Gaza, the first phase includes the removal of debris, which was completed in 65 days, with 85,000 cubic meters of rubble lifted The second phase includes six projects, most notably the development of the corniche waterfront (northern Gaza), which was initiated where the equipment arrived and excavation and filling work was carried out. There is also the establishment of residential communities called Dar Misr throughout the Gaza Strip. This phase includes the development of important intersections in Shujaiya square and Saraya by establishing two bridges to solve bottlenecks in the two areas. Egypt, which was had a leading role in a ceasefire agreement between Israel and Palestinian factions, sent an engineering delegation to the Gaza Strip in mid-September to discuss reconstruction projects and push forward their implementation
